Alex Albright discusses The Forgotten First: B-1 and the Integration of the Modern Navy, with appearances by B-1 bandsmen Abe Thurman, John Mason, Huey Lawrence, Calvin Morrow, and Simeon Holloway

B-1 was the first of over 100 bands of African American musicians who served the U.S. Navy at postings throughout the U.S. and the Pacific during World War II. Join us for this compelling conversation about one of history’s most important military bands, and hear first-hand about the experiences of B-1 bandsmen during and after the war.
